Types of innovation

• Business Model – changes in the way you do business (Apple, Dell, IKEA, Intel)

• Process – changes in the way you make, deliver or handle business processes (Wal-Mart, Toyota)

• Product -- product or service change

Screen/pick best application

Fit with Strategy/MissionCompellingness of needMargin/Profit potentialMarket sizePotential Market growthBarriers to entry – competition, customer powerFit with capabilities/resources

Page 17: The  fuzzy  front end of Innovation

“Killer Application”

• Most viable application from criteria screening

• May need to refine Value Proposition

• Keep in mind: Can this be applied to other markets later?
